😐A single person spends $1,266 per month in Playa del Carmen vs $240 in Moshi,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$2,279 per month in Playa del Carmen vs $416 in Moshi,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$3,292 per month in Playa del Carmen vs $591 in Moshi, rent included.
😐Playa del Carmen costs about 428% more than Moshi,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Both Playa del Carmen and Moshi are more affordable than the global median – Playa del Carmen7% lower, Moshi82% lower.
